Durability & Maintenance
This Thermo Scientific model is built for longevity in demanding environments. Its robust construction suggests it will withstand years of regular use in laboratory and industrial settings. The fully encapsulated temperature sensor and durable probe materials are designed to resist chemical wear and physical damage common in these applications.
Maintenance is primarily focused on probe care. The pH electrode requires proper storage in a suitable solution to prevent drying out, a standard procedure for all pH electrodes. The conductivity cell is relatively low maintenance, typically requiring rinsing after each use. The meter itself, with its sealed buttons and display, is resistant to minor splashes and dust, making it easy to keep clean.
